Comparison and Analysis of Algorithms for the 0/1 Knapsack Problem

Xiaohui Pan, Tao Zhang

Open full text 12 citations

Abstract

The 0/1 knapsack problem is a typical problem in the field of operational research and combinatorial optimization, and it belongs to the NP problem.Research on the solutions of the 0/1 knapsack problem algorithm has very important practical value.This paper first described the 0/1 knapsack problem, and then presented the algorithm analysis, design and implementation of the 0/1 knapsack problem using the brute force algorithm, the greedy algorithm, the genetic algorithm and the dynamic programming algorithm, and compared the four algorithms in terms of algorithm complexity and accuracy.On this basis, the future research directions of the 0/1 knapsack problem were analysed, and we proposed to use the rough set theory to solve the 0/1 knapsack problem.This paper can provide insight for solving the 0/1 knapsack problem and applications.
